Avalon Fishing Pier offers everything you need for a long, enjoyable day (or night!) of fishing. First built in 1958, Avalon Fishing Pier is about 700 feet long, stretching out to the Atlantic Ocean over 12 to 15 feet of water.  Located at...

The Avon Fishing Pier is a Hatteras Island landmark, attracting fishermen from all over the country who want to try their luck at reeling in one of the notoriously large red drums that make seasonal appearances.

Jennette’s Pier in Nags Head offers fishing and fun for the entire family! Go fishing, take a family fishing class or simply walk out to the end of this 1,000-foot-long, concrete ocean pier.
